Beretta 92FS Brigadier 9mm 4.90″ 10+1 – A Trusted Partner for Family Shooting
The beretta 92fs brigadier 9mm 4.90″ 10+1 is a double/single-action semiautomatic pistol built to help you and your family shoot with confidence. Its heavier slide and open-slide, short-recoil locking-block system reduce common stoppages like stove-piping, so you spend more time on target and less time clearing malfunctions. With a 4.90-inch barrel and a 10+1 capacity, this Brigadier model gives you reliable performance right out of the box.
| Manufacturer | Beretta |
|---|---|
| Model | 92FS Brigadier |
| Material | Steel slide, aluminum alloy frame, rubber grip (per manufacturer specs) |
| Compatibility | 9mm Luger ammunition |
| Finish | Bruniton black finish |
| Weight | 33.3 oz (empty, per manufacturer specs) |
| Condition | New |

FAQ
Is the Beretta 92FS Brigadier good for beginners?
Yes. The double/single-action trigger adds an extra safety step for new shooters, and the heavier slide helps tame recoil. The rubber grip also makes it easier to hold steady while learning proper stance and grip.
What magazines does the 92FS Brigadier use?
It uses standard Beretta 92-series 10-round magazines. Two are included with the pistol. You can also use higher-capacity 92-series magazines if your state allows them.
Can I mount a red dot on the Brigadier slide?
The factory slide is not optics-ready, but you can have it milled by a gunsmith or use a dovetail mount. Many shooters choose to keep the three-dot sights for simplicity.
How do I clean the open-slide design?
The open-slide makes cleaning easier because you can access the barrel and locking block without disassembling the slide. Use a standard bore brush and solvent, then wipe the slide rails clean.
What is the difference between the 92FS and the Brigadier?
The Brigadier has a heavier, reinforced slide with serrations on the front and rear. It’s designed to reduce felt recoil and improve durability for high-round-count shooters.
